CITY OF BROOKLYN CENTER
Notice is hereby given that a public hearing will be held on the 10th day of
November, 1986 at 7:30 p.m. at City Hall, 6301 Shingle Creek Parkway, to
consider an amendment to Chapter 23 regarding the deletion of liquor
license fees.'
Auxiliary aids for handicapped persons are available upon request at
.least 96 hours in advance. Please contact the Personnel Coordinator at 561-
5440 to make arrangements.
